  1. Apr 27, 2006 · Documentary about one of the world's most popular suicide spots, the Golden Gate Bridge in San Francisco. Filmed over the course of a year, it captures a number of suicides and features interviews with the friends and family of some of the people identified to have jumped from the bridge.

  3. The Bridge on the River Kwai is now widely recognized as one of the greatest films ever made. It was the highest-grossing film of 1957 and received overwhelmingly positive reviews from critics. The film won seven Academy Awards (including Best Picture) at the 30th Academy Awards.

  8. 4 days ago · The Bridge on the River Kwai, British -American war film, released in 1957 and directed by David Lean, that was both a critical and popular success and became an enduring classic. The movie garnered seven Academy Awards, including that for best picture, as well as three Golden Globe Awards and four BAFTA awards.
